COURSE OUTLINE

Day 1: Foundations of Human Resource Management

  • Overview of the human resource management course structure and objectives.
  • Understanding the scope and evolution of HRM.
  • Key functions: staffing, development, motivation, and maintenance.
  • Organizational structure and HR roles.
  • Legal frameworks and compliance in HR practices.
  • The impact of globalization on human resource management HRM.
  • The strategic value of HR in achieving business outcomes.
  • Difference between personnel management and HRM.
  • Benefits of completing a human resource management certification.

Day 2: Recruitment, Selection, and Onboarding

  • Developing effective job descriptions and specifications.
  • Workforce planning with company goals.
  • Recruitment channels and sourcing strategies.
  • Behavioral interview techniques and evaluation methods.
  • Legal considerations in selection and hiring.
  • Role of AI and technology in modern recruitment.
  • Designing effective onboarding programs for engagement.
  • Onboarding case study: Onboarding in high-growth environments.
  • HR's role in early-stage employee retention.

Day 3: Performance Management and Employee Development

  • Components of performance appraisal systems.
  • SMART goal setting and KPI tracking.
  • Conducting feedback sessions and coaching conversations.
  • Addressing underperformance constructively.
  • Identifying training needs and learning paths.
  • Structuring internal promotion frameworks.
  • Role of succession planning in organizational growth.
  • Linking performance outcomes to rewards and recognition.
  • Tools used in human resource management training and development.

Day 4: Employee Relations, Compliance, and Workplace Culture

  • Understanding employee rights and employer obligations.
  • Managing workplace conflict and grievance processes.
  • Enhancing employee satisfaction through communication.
  • Policy development for conduct, attendance, and safety.
  • Promoting inclusion, equity, and diversity.
  • Organizational ethics and employee discipline.
  • Preventing harassment and ensuring a safe workplace.
  • HR audits and compliance tracking tools.
  • Case study: building a culture of transparency and trust.

Day 5: HR Analytics and Strategic Human Resource Management

  • Introduction to HR analytics and HR data dashboards.
  • Using data to support strategic HR planning.
  • Employee turnover analysis and reporting.
  • Linking HR metrics with business KPIs.
  • Exploring human resource management diploma advantages.
  • Strategic HRM: Aligning talent strategy with business needs.
  • Building resilient HR strategies during change.
  • Benchmarking HR practices across industries.
  • Capstone activity: designing an HRM strategy for a startup.
